New Plantings on 7 Hill


When the club was given permission by the town to remove pine trees located on the hillside on 7 it was with the stipulation that new plants had to be added to the general area.  We selected some bushes and other plants from local nurseries and have begun the process of planting them on the hillside.  The plants will be located further up the hillside where they will not be detrimental to the quality of turf but rather add a nice visual when playing the hole.  These plants are all native species which will also have a positive impact on the wildlife of the course.

Bunker Work

The past few days the staff has been moving or adding sand to the bunkers where needed. Once and is moved around or added it helps provide a consistent depth throughout.  The plate compactor is used to compact the bunker faces and floors. This will help keep bunkers firm in an effort to minimize a 'fried egg' lie. This process is fairly labor intensive so we are only able to get to it a few times per season.

Irrigation

Leveling heads on the golf course is important for a couple of different reasons. Usually it takes anywhere from 10 to 20 minutes to level ahead. Yesterday the staff went to level ahead on the 8th fairway and uncovered this lovely mess as seen in the picture. All of these wires supply power to the fairway and for some reason we're piled up in the ground next to this head. It is amazing that everything was still in working!  To clean up all of these wires, each wire has to be cut and spliced back together in a neat fashion. This involves cutting every wire and figuring out which wires power each station.

Monday, November 25, 2013

Irrigation Blowout
























We have begun blowing out the irrigation system today.  In the northern part of the country it is necessary to remove any water from within an irrigation system as the ground typically freezes in the winter months.  The process will take a few days to remove any water inside the pipes.

Drainage on 14




Before we could complete the expanded collar behind 14 green there were drainage issues that had to be addressed.  New drainage was added along with tying into existing drainage.  The water that builds up behind the green will now have adequate passage out of the new expanded area.

5 Tee Construction



















As part of the renovation this fall, the contractor also expanded and resodded the black tee on hole 5.  The tee area was too small and was not able to handle the amount of play that it received over the course of the year.  The new larger tee will hopefully be able to handle more golfers with no problems.
